Rules for writing spelling sentences: 8 words in the declarative and the interrogative sentences. Each sentence needs a capital letter. Each sentence needs punctuation at the end. Must use the spelling word as spelled in the list. no suffixes or prefixes added. May not start the sentence with a pronoun. Try to use adjectives before the noun. Instead of writing: 'The man is funny.' write: 'The funny man wore a pink hat to work. Use the word with its proper part of speech. Use nouns as nouns, verbs as verbs. |
